Biggest gig must have been "VG Lista Topp20 - Rådghusplassen" in Oslo sentrum 2005.
About 70.000(!) people that year...This is a show hosted by Norway's biggest newspaper and the official single chart(sort of like "Top of the Pops")
I did some "in between artist dj'ing"..nothing huge for me though, since I wasn't advertised or mentioned in the offical program..hehe
(Btw, more then 100.000 was attending last year, and about 130,000 is expected this summer. I'll see if I can get an opening again)

Almost equally big was playing at "Summer Parade" in Oslo. I would guess somewhere in between 40-60.000 people.
The only problem with gigs like that is that you kinda "drown in the crowd" as a lot of DJ's and artists are doing their thing at the same show.

Most fun gig on the other hand must have been DJ'ing before and under Fatman Scoop's live show in Oslo.
He's a real funny guy, and wheter you like his music or not, he really know how to move a crowd...
